Re: Kernel 2.4 on potato



On Wed, Dec 27, 2000 at 02:28:33PM +0400, Rino Mardo wrote:
> > 
> > I'm using kernel 2.4 on my potato box without any problems. I've installed
> > modutils from woody to recognize new directories organization under
> > /lib/modules/ and ppp package from woody to make ppp work as a module with
> > such modutils configuration:
> > 
> > alias char-major-108    ppp_generic
> > alias /dev/ppp          ppp_generic
> > alias tty-ldisc-3       ppp_async
> > alias tty-ldisc-14      ppp_synctty
> > alias ppp-compress-21   bsd_comp
> > alias ppp-compress-24   ppp_deflate
> > alias ppp-compress-26   ppp_deflate
> > 
> > With these two modifications everything works just fine. Here you have
> > official list of needed packages from kernel 2.4.0-test10 source:
> > 
> > 
> > o  Gnu C                  2.91.66          # gcc --version
> > o  Gnu make               3.77             # make --version
> > o  binutils               2.9.1.0.25       # ld -v
> > o  util-linux             2.10o            # kbdrate -v
> > o  modutils               2.3.18           # insmod -V
> > o  e2fsprogs              1.19             # tune2fs --version
> > o  pcmcia-cs              3.1.21           # cardmgr -V
> > o  PPP                    2.4.0            # pppd --version
> > o  isdn4k-utils           3.1beta7         # isdnctrl 2>&1|grep version
> > 
> > BTW I use e2fsprogs 1.18 from potato without any problems. Any other newer
> > packages like pcmcia-cs or isdn4-utils I don't use so I don't care about
> > them.

> i've done the check and one thing i would like to confirm is the
> following:
> 
> Gnu C		2.95.2
> Gnu make	3.79.1
> binutils	2.9.5
> 

I use exactly the same versions - versions from potato distribution. List
above is from original /usr/src/linux/Documentation/Changes file and in
most cases lists MINIMAL versions of programs needed. So it's not a
problem for most programs when you have higher version.

> this are the versions on my potato box.  comparing to your listing would
> it matter if i use them with kernel-2.4.0-test12 (or whatever is the
> latest)?
> 

List of required packages for kernel 2.4.0-test12 is exactly the same
(I've checked patches 2.4.0-test11 and 2.4.0-test12 and don't see any
changes to the list above). I've compiled 2.4.0-test12 without problems
but this kernel is weird for me - it has problems with dosemu and with
ReiserFS, which I need, so I decided to stay with -test10 version and wait
for final 2.4.0. But this was bad for me - if you don't use dosemu and
ReiserFS just give it a try, without them it works just fine.

Good Luck and remember - you can always return to normal stable 2.2.x so
you risk not so much ;-)
